Good average bench

The Nvidia GTX 1080 (Mobile Max-Q) averaged 21.8% lower than the peak scores attained by the group leaders. This is an excellent result which ranks the Nvidia GTX 1080 (Mobile Max-Q) near the top of the comparison list.

Good consistency

The range of scores (95th - 5th percentile) for the Nvidia GTX 1080 (Mobile Max-Q) is 24.2%. This is a relatively narrow range which indicates that the Nvidia GTX 1080 (Mobile Max-Q) performs reasonably consistently under varying real world conditions.
